[objective-c] UIButton शीर्षक UILabel फ़ॉन्ट आकार प्रोग्रामेटिक रूप से सेट करें



6 Answers

[button setFont:...] को हटा दिया गया है।

[button.titleLabel setFont:...] उपयोग करें, उदाहरण के लिए:

[myButton.titleLabel setFont:[UIFont systemFontOfSize:10]];

Question

मुझे प्रोग्रामिंग के UILabel के शीर्षक UILabel के फ़ॉन्ट आकार को सेट करने की आवश्यकता है।




स्विफ्ट:

shareButton.titleLabel?.font = UIFont.systemFontOfSize(size)

महत्वहीन नोट: एनिमसन द्वारा हटाया गया ♦ 5 दिसंबर '14 16:48 पर
एनिम्यूसन, इस जवाब को पोस्ट करने के एक महीने बाद मुझे एक ही समस्या थी। मैं गुगल रहा था और इस पोस्ट को पाया जो आसानी से एक त्वरित परियोजना में पेस्ट करने योग्य नहीं था। जबकि मैं स्क्रॉल कर रहा था, मैंने अपना हटाया जवाब देखा और इसे कॉपी किया। तो कृपया वास्तव में उपयोगी सामान को हटाएं ..




उद्देश्य सी:

[button.titleLabel setFont: [button.titleLabel.font fontWithSize: sizeYouWant]];

स्विफ्ट:

button.titleLabel?.font = button.titleLabel?.font.fontWithSize(sizeYouWant)

फ़ॉन्ट आकार बदलने से ज्यादा कुछ नहीं करेगा।




यह आपको जाना चाहिए

[btn_submit.titleLabel setFont:[UIFont systemFontOfSize:14.0f]];



button.titleLabel.font = <whatever font you want>

लोगों के लिए सोच रहा है कि उनका पाठ क्यों नहीं दिख रहा है, अगर आप करते हैं

button.titleLabel.text = @"something";

यह दिखाई नहीं देगा, आपको करने की ज़रूरत है:

[button setTitle:@"My title" forState:UIControlStateNormal]; //or whatever you want the control state to be



यह सहायक होगा

button.titleLabel.font = [UIFont fontWithName:@"YOUR FONTNAME" size:12.0f]



this may help :

[objBtn.titleLabel setFont:[UIFont fontWithName:@“fontname” size:fontsize]];



Related